    Re: barren condition

    I fished Sat through Tuesday and had decent luck. Caught several nice bass on top water and had a couple real decent ones break me off. Experimented with some different line and lesson learned. Fish I caught were shallow (close to deeper water) and they were caught on a slow moving chug bug/pop r. Could not get them to touch soft plastics or a jig and had to be real patient with the top water but they were aggressive when they decided to strike. I pulled the hooks from deep in their gullet several times. Water fell a half a foot a day the whole time I was there and seemed pretty clear.

    Re: barren condition

    Sorry it took me a few days to get to this, been real busy....however, we did hit Barren this last memorial day Monday. We had a great day, and boated several keepers, largest around 4 lbs. We went up Skaggs and hit all the coves and creeks we came across. What seemed to work for us was heading to the backs of the coves were the water was around 7-9ft deep. We threw cranks that dove around 4-6 ft, and had the most luck on sexy shad and bluegill patterned cranks. We hit the first cove, and I limitted out in about 10 min! It was fast and furious! I would say I would have ended up with a 15-16lb bag. Lots of fun. I also caught two hybrids while cranking that each went around 4lbs. Man they fight! The water looked great, and the debry was minimal. Hoping to head back out this next week. Good luck to all!
